IxiCash Supply
10,170,322,439 IXI
Active DLT Nodes
134
Estimated Hashrate
25,714,518 h/s

Total Transactions
93,227,932
24h Transactions
2,445
Average transactions per Day
41,131

Blocks

Height Hash Added Txs